Township to Talk Wildlife Feeding Regulations at Committee Meeting

In place of last month's modified Wildlife Feeding Regulations, which prohibited the feeding of wildlife on private and public properties, the committee will vote on a "Peace and Good Order"

Back on the township committee agenda tonight is an ordinance that will address feeding geese on public and private properties in Lacey. After receiving much pushback from residents last month, the committee tabled a modified version of its Wildlife Feeding Regulations, which would prohibit the feeding of wildlife on all private and public properties. As part of the township’s geese population management plan, the committee crafted the modified ordinance. Feeding wildlife on public property, which the committee says contributes to the presence of geese, had already been illegal.
